The global 3D printing market has experienced substantial growth over the past decade, fueled by rapid advancements in technology and an increasing need for customized, on-demand production. Initially adopted in prototyping and product development, 3D printing has evolved into a mainstream manufacturing process, now being applied across sectors such as aerospace, automotive, healthcare, consumer goods, and industrial manufacturing. Its ability to create complex geometries with reduced waste and shorter lead times makes it a highly attractive technology for both established industries and innovative startups.
3D printing—or additive manufacturing—enables the fabrication of objects layer by layer from digital models, offering unparalleled flexibility compared to traditional subtractive processes. This evolution is underpinned by continuous improvements in materials, software, and printer capabilities, which have expanded the range of applications and improved cost-effectiveness. As supply chains face pressures for customization and rapid production cycles, 3D printing is increasingly seen as a strategic tool for achieving competitive advantage in a globalized economy.

The global 3D printing market is characterized by its rapid evolution and broad application scope. Initially confined to rapid prototyping, 3D printing now supports full-scale production across a range of industries. The market is witnessing growing adoption of both metal and polymer-based 3D printing technologies, as well as emerging methods that leverage bioprinting and hybrid manufacturing processes.

Global Dynamics
Regions such as North America and Europe have long been at the forefront of 3D printing innovation, driven by robust research and development ecosystems, established industrial bases, and supportive regulatory environments. However, emerging markets in Asia-Pacific, Latin America, and the Middle East are rapidly catching up as governments and private enterprises invest in advanced manufacturing technologies to boost economic growth. The convergence of technology, demand for localized production, and the need for sustainable manufacturing practices continues to propel the global 3D printing market forward.
